Who Are Nontraditional Students at SUNY Oswego?
Nontraditional students at SUNY Oswego fall into several categories.
We serve:
- Part-time students
- Online students
- Students who return to school after a prolonged absence
- Students who delayed enrollment into postsecondary education
- Veteran & military students
- Working parents and more
Nontraditional students frequently have different needs than traditional students.
